Create and work with photo albums on iPhone

Use albums in the Photos app to view and organize your photos and videos. You can also rename, rearrange, and delete albums and create folders to contain multiple albums.

The Albums collection in the Photos app. A grid of albums is on the screen. At the top of the screen, from left to right, are the Back, New Album, and More buttons. Below that are buttons to view albums by Personal, Shared, or Activity. At the bottom of the screen, from left to right, are the Library, Collections, and Search buttons.

If you use iCloud Photos, albums are stored in iCloud. They’re up to date and accessible on devices where you’re signed in to the same Apple Account. See Back up and sync your photos and videos with iCloud.

Create a new album

  1. Go to the Photos app on your iPhone.

  2. Tap Collections.

  3. Tap Albums, then tap the Add button.

  4. Tap New Album, then name the album, add photos, and choose a key photo to represent the album.

  5. Tap Create.

To create an album that you can collaborate on with other people, see Create shared albums.

Sort albums

  1. Go to the Photos app on your iPhone.

  2. Tap Collections.

  3. Tap Albums, tap the More button, then choose a sort option.

    If you choose Sort by Custom Order, touch and hold an album, then drag it to a new position.

  4. To show only albums or only folders, tap the More button, tap Filter, then choose an option.

To change the format of the albums list, tap the More button, then select List View or Key Photo.

Rename an album

  1. Go to the Photos app on your iPhone.

  2. Tap Collections, then tap Albums.

  3. Touch and hold the album you want to rename.

  4. Tap Edit Title and Photos.

  5. Enter the new name in the text field, then tap Done.

Share photos from an album

  1. Go to the Photos app on your iPhone.

  2. Tap Collections, then tap Albums.

  3. Tap the album to open it, then tap Select.

  4. Tap the items you want to share, or tap Select All to share everything in the album.

  5. Tap the Share button, then choose a sharing option such as AirDrop, Messages, or Mail.

Delete an album

  1. Go to the Photos app on your iPhone.

  2. Tap Collections, then tap Albums.

  3. Touch and hold the album you want to delete.

  4. Tap Delete Album.

Note: When you delete an album, the photos and videos within it remain in your photo library and any other albums they were added to.

Organize albums in folders

You can create folders to organize your albums. After you create a folder, it appears in the Albums collection.

  1. Go to the Photos app on your iPhone.

  2. Tap Collections, then tap Albums.

  3. Tap the Add button.

  4. Tap New Folder, then name the folder and add albums to it.

  5. Tap Create.

To remove an album from a folder, tap the folder to open it, touch and hold an album, then tap Remove from Folder.
